310 and other single axle - Leaf spring Weld

Hello,

I encountered a new problem. I replaced the leaf springs. I gave it to a company and they cut and welded the U bracket on and they welded the ends of the leaf springs together. As I remember it was like this at the original spring. But the moment I did lift the Motorhome with the airbags - on one side the welds came off. The other side is okay. My question is now, how should it be - the ends welded together or not?

Those leaves shouldn't be welded together on the ends, as they flex they all change lengths, mine did not have the leaves welded together, I would grind them all off and separate them

They should not have welded the U-bolt either.

I would take it to a welder who understands and has worked on leaf springs.

And if it was welded properly with good penetration it wouldn't bust out like shown in your picture.
